West and Lower Queen Anne

A walk-loving friend was picking up a kindergartner on Queen Anne this afternoon so we took the opportunity to have lunch at Macrina Bakery and walk streets in West and Lower Queen Anne. Our 3.6 mile walk took us down and up some steep staircases.













We passed some lovely homes, an impressive wall with a staircase leading up to 8th Place W (near Marshall Park and Parsons Gardens)

and the lovely Kinnear Park with its playground and lookout which offered great Sound views (as well as a view of the grain elevators on Pier 86) and some philosophy.

We were rewarded with a view of the Space Needle

and noted the name "Epler Place" at the base of a street sign that told us we were on 7th and Olympic. It seems that "The street names in Seattle ... were “rationalized” in the mid-1890s. In many instances historical names were dropped for numbers."

Another enjoyable walk and the hills gave us a real workout.
